The speaker will be Professor Henry Hutchinson formerly Director of the Central Laser Facility of the CLRC Rutherford Appleton Laboratory, Imperial College London and the University of Bordeaux, France. The subject of his talk will be : "Prospects for Laser Fusion Energy"
Research towards the development of controlled nuclear fusion as a future source of clean energy is discussed. The approaches employed for its generation will be described with particular reference to the use of high power lasers to create the extreme conditions of temperature and pressure required to ignite a small pellet of hydrogen isotopes and demonstrate the basic science required for the production of energy.
